The scope of legal protection for listed buildings
This List entry helps identify the building designated at this address for its special architectural or historic interest.
Unless the List entry states otherwise, it includes both the structure itself and any object or structure fixed to it (whether inside or outside) as well as any object or structure within the curtilage of the building.
For these purposes, to be included within the curtilage of the building, the object or structure must have formed part of the land since before 1st July 1948.

Details
COTHERSTONE LARTINGTON LANE NZ 01 NW (North side,off) 16/50 Towler Hill Farmhouse II Farmhouse, now 2 dwellings. Mid C18 house and late C18-early C19 left section, the latter a byre conversion. Squared rubble; sandstone-flagged roof and stone chimney stacks. Continuous, 2-storey front: 3-bay house, and left section of 2 wide bays. Flush quoins at ends and at joint between sections. Openings have stone, flat-arched lintels with segmental tops. Left section openings altered in late C20. Replaced 2-pane sashes.
House to right has central replaced glazed door and overlight; paired sashes in late C20 opening to left, single sash to right and 3 windows above. Left section has replaced partly-glazed door to right; single and paired sashes to left and 2 windows above. Continuous roof has coped gables and a coping above junction; all copings have shaped kneelers. Right end stack, central and left ridge stacks; all with top bands and water tables. Rear has scattered, replaced 2-pane sashes.
Interior: right ground-floor room of original farmhouse has large stone fireplace with projecting lintel on corbelled jambs.
